Outreach Coordinator & Program Admissions Advisor, Division of Advanced Professional Teacher Development and International Education

The George Mason University College of Education and Human Development (CEHD) is seeking an energetic and self-motivated individual to serve as Outreach Coordinator and Program Admissions Advisor to strengthen a dynamic and diverse team in the Division of Advanced Professional Teacher Development and International Education (APTDIE). George Mason University has a strong institutional commitment to the achievement of excellence and diversity among its faculty and staff, and strongly encourages candidates to apply who will enrich Mason’s academic and culturally inclusive environment.

The Outreach Coordinator and Program Admissions Advisor will support a full-time Outreach and Marketing professional to market and recruit applicants, support the creation of outreach materials, conduct information outreach, provide advice on admissions procedures and program details, support applicants’ admissions process into the graduate teacher education programs in the division. This full-time, classified position offers a supportive work environment, opportunities to work both independently and creatively in concert with Academic Program Coordinators and the Outreach and Marketing Coordinator to design and enhance our marketing and outreach efforts.

Responsibilities:

  • In partnership with the CEHD Admissions Office and APTDIE division faculty, implement marketing and advertising campaigns reaching K-12 educators, administrators and leaders in the region, state, and internationally to increase visibility of and enrollment within graduate education programs in the division;
  • Produce promotional materials by designing documents in accordance with Mason’s brand, coordinating requirements with the CEHD Admissions Office, ordering materials, and tracking production;
  • Collaborate with a variety of stakeholders including faculty, administrative professionals, admissions representatives, product vendors, and leaders in a broad outreach of schools and school districts;
  • Build rapport with prospective students through information sessions delivered in multiple fomats, recruitment events, one-on-one advising sessions, phone inquiries and broader communications to support them through the application process;
  • Maintain prospective student database, and track students and applicants from initial contact through enrollment; and
  • Engage in successful initiatives while developing new marketing and outreach strategies, including social media, to promote program enrollment.


Required Qualifications:
  • Bachelor’s degree, or an equivalent combination of education and experience;
  • Self-starter with strong and effective communication and marketing skills;
  • Ability to build relationships with prospective students to ensure successful application experience; and
  • Skilled in the use of technology to find and track prospective students and applicants. Preferred Qualifications:
  • Master’s degree; and
  • Experience working with CRMs; and
  • Experience working in K-12 education or higher education settings.

George Mason University is a university with three campuses, each with a distinctive academic focus that plays a critical role in the economy of its region. At each campus, students, faculty, and staff have full access to all the university's resources, while duplication of programs and support services is minimized through the use of technology. In addition to the main campus in Fairfax, the university has campuses in Arlington and Prince William Counties.
